Actually, it's not nessecary to send off the form, and it doesn't require an Elite. Best thing to do is give MS customer support a ring. IIRC they wanted to know the serial # of my Xbox, my old Drive and the new 60gb i was replacing it with, and then they were quite happy to supply me with one for my Premium. There were a few days of waiting for the kit to arrive after purchasing the 60gb live starter kit thing.
